Email received just now: Security Alert - U.S. Embassy Bangkok (January 7, 2020) Location: Thailand Event: Heightened Middle East Tensions There is heightened tension in the Middle East that may result in security risks to U.S. citizens abroad. The Embassy will continue to review the security situation and will provide additional information as needed. Enroll in the Smart Traveler Enrollment Program (STEP) to receive travel alerts.Actions to Take: · Be aware of your surroundings. · Stay alert in locations frequented by tourists. · Report suspicious activity to the Royal Thai Police (emergency number 191). · Review your personal security plans. · Have travel documents up to date and easily accessible.Assistance: U.S. Embassy Bangkok, Thailand American Citizens Services +66 2 205 4049 +66 2 205 4000 (after hours) [email protected] State Department - Consular Affairs +1 888 407 4747 or +1 202 501 4444 Thailand Country Information Enroll in Smart Traveler Enrollment Program (STEP) to receive security updates Follow us on Facebook and Twitter I would imagine other embassies are doing the same, but I am not sure if this is specific to Thailand due to a credible threat that has been discovered.
